Thinking in Colour (14-17 years)

This group helps to start teens learn how to think in more flexible ways. It will start to teach them that situations are not just "all good" or "all bad," but can be somewhere in between.

In the program, teens will practice noticing different possibilities and learning that it is okay to feel unsure sometimes. The will practice how to change strict black and white thoughts into more balanced and realistic ones. These skills aim to teach teens how to manage their feelings, understand others better, and handle every day situations more successfully.
